      Summary

      Easily create API proxies and custom APIs backed by IBM Cloud Functions, Cloud Foundry apps, and App Connect flows. An API Gateway service enables you to securely share your APIs with other developers.

       

      The API Gateway service can handle APIs located in resource groups. APIs located in Cloud Foundry spaces are handled by an automatically-provisioned Legacy API Gateway. Both gateway types are tightly integrated with common services like Log Analysis, Activity Tracker, App ID, Certificate Manager, and more.

      Features

      Create APIs

      Create API proxies and custom APIs backed by IBM Cloud resources. View API gateway logs and short-term API performance and usage statistics during development.

      Secure APIs

      Secure your APIs by requiring API key/secret and OAuth social login. Apply rate limits to protect your back end applications.

      Share APIs

      Share OpenAPI documentation and API keys with other developers both within and outside of IBM Cloud. Brand your APIs by assigning them to custom domains.
